Early functions to recapitulate aspects of gastrulation ended up executed utilizing mouse stem cells. The 1st absolute 3D gastruloid was developed by van den Brink and colleagues in 201469. Consisting of only 300 mouse ES cells, the EB was cultured in vitro to produce a 3D gastruloid, wherever hallmarks of early mouse embryonic advancement, including symmetry breaking and axial Firm, ended up observable beneath the activation of WNT/β-catenin signaling, which even further brought on germ layer specification and insignificant axial elongation on the addition of certain morphogens such as CHIR99021 and Activin A77.

The development of in vitro tradition methods also performed an important function from the establishment of ESCs. Evans pioneered using irradiated chick embryo fibroblasts as feeder cells to society mammalian stem cells in vitro, which enabled the maintenance and enlargement of pluripotent stem cells (PSCs)19. Determined by these findings, Evans, Kaufman, and Martin effectively derived mouse ESCs (mESCs) through the ICM of blastocysts, marking the beginning of modern stem cell research20,21.
